[4], In July 2005, the church announced that, due to the great distance members of the Third and Fourth Quorums of the Seventy had to travel to meet as quorums, the Seventh and Eighth Quorums of the Seventy would be created. Similarly, the Utah Area extends into parts of Idaho, Wyoming, Nevada and Arizona, as North America areas are based more on population centers than state boundaries, unlike the international boundaries followed by the areas outside the U.S. and Canada. Though all Seventies have equal authority, some are designated as General Authorities and others are designated as Area Seventies. The first two quorums are made up of General Authority Seventies and the third through the twelfth consist of Area Seventies.
